Lauren F. Louis

U.S. Magistrate Judge, U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Florida

Lauren F. Louis is a U.S. Magistrate Judge on the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Florida, appointed to a renewable 8-year term in 2018. Sources ↓

Questions & answers

Who appoints magistrate judges of the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Florida?
Magistrate judges are appointed by the district's judges to a renewable eight-year term.
Which court is Lauren F. Louis on?
Lauren F. Louis is a U.S. Magistrate Judge on the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Florida.
